Bonus Math
Bonuses are a key part of online gaming, and Ladbrokes offers a welcome bonus that can be a great boost. However, understanding how bonuses work is crucial to making the most of them. Let’s break down the math with a hypothetical example.
Assume the welcome bonus is a 100% match on your first deposit, up to a certain amount, say £100. This means if you deposit £50, you get an additional £50 in bonus funds, giving you £100 to play with. But that money is not free—you need to meet wagering requirements before you can withdraw any winnings from it.
Wagering requirements are expressed as a multiplier, often 30x or 40x. So, if the requirement is 30x the bonus amount, you must wager £50 * 30 = £1,500 before the bonus becomes cash. If the requirement is 30x (deposit + bonus), then it would be (£50 + £50) * 30 = £3,000. Always read the terms to know which applies.
Let’s calculate the expected value. Suppose the wagering requirement is 35x the bonus, and the game you play has an RTP of 96%. This means the house edge is 4%. Over the course of wagering £1,750 (35 * £50), your expected loss is £1,750 * 0.04 = £70. So, your expected net result after completing the wagering is the initial deposit plus bonus minus losses: £50 + £50 – £70 = £30. So, on average, you would end with £30 from your original £50 deposit. But this can vary with luck.
If you play a game with a higher RTP of 98%, your expected loss is £35, so your expected net would be £65. Thus, bonus hunting is more profitable with high RTP games.
Also, note that some bets may not count fully towards wagering, such as table games or progressive jackpots. Check the bonus terms for the list of allowed games and their contribution percentages.

Good to Know
Maximize your chances by playing games with a high Return to Player (RTP). Blackjack typically offers an RTP of around 99.5% when played with perfect strategy. This is your best bet. Video poker can be close to 99% if you pick the right paytable. European roulette has an RTP of 97.3%, while American roulette is lower at 94.7% due to the extra zero.
On the flip side, avoid progressive jackpot slots, which often have RTPs below 90% because a portion of every bet goes to the jackpot. Also steer clear of keno, with RTPs often below 90%. Instead, look for slots with RTP in the 96-98% range, which are common on the site. Follow this advice, and you will stretch your bankroll further.
